(https://www.podbean.com/user-rmMMqRcvRuqN)The 55 U.S. states and territories determine their very own licensing requirements, which means this procedure can vary a little bit relying on where you live, consisting of the style education you require. Education and learning: In the bulk of united state territories, architects need to earn a degree from a style program approved by the National Architectural Accreditation Board (NAAB) to get approved for licensure.

Variables such as the. A lot of designers function in an office-based setup, however today it's typical for designers to have the possibility to work from home either part time or full-time.


Designers may need to leave the office or home sometimes to perform site gos to, either to assess a website for a future construct or to sign in on jobs that remain in progress and work with the various other experts who are involved in the real building. Just how much they do this truly depends upon the individuallead or senior engineers that are heading a project might be expected to do this regularly than the architects they supervise.
